1. Computer Hardware & Virtualization
A security analyst is investigating a workstation that has become
extremely slow when multiple applications are running simultaneously.
The system has sufficient disk space, but monitoring shows that physical
memory is almost completely consumed and the operating system is
repeatedly moving inactive memory pages between RAM and disk.
Which hardware resource is most directly responsible for this behavior?
A) CPU cache
B) RAM
C) GPU VRAM
D) Network interface buffer
Answer: B) RAM
Rationale: RAM is the primary volatile memory used by the operating
system and running applications. When physical RAM becomes
scarce, the operating system can use disk-based virtual memory, such
as a paging file or swap space. Disk storage is substantially slower
than RAM, so excessive paging can cause severe performance
degradation. CPU cache is much faster but considerably smaller and
is not normally used as the primary backing store for application
memory.

,2. Computer Hardware & Virtualization
An organization wants to run several isolated operating systems on a
single physical server. Each guest operating system should believe that it
has access to its own CPU, memory, storage, and network resources.
Which technology most directly provides this capability?
A) RAID
B) Virtualization
C) DNS
D) NAT
Answer: B) Virtualization
Rationale: Virtualization abstracts physical computing resources and
allows multiple virtual machines to operate on one physical host. A
hypervisor manages the allocation of CPU, memory, storage, and
networking resources to the virtual machines. RAID provides storage
redundancy or performance improvements, DNS resolves names, and
NAT translates network addresses.


3. Computer Hardware & Virtualization
A company uses containers to deploy applications. An administrator
mistakenly claims that containers provide the same degree of hardware-
level isolation as conventional virtual machines because every container
contains its own complete operating-system kernel. Which statement
correctly identifies the problem?
A) Containers cannot communicate over networks
B) Containers generally share the host operating-system kernel
C) Containers require a separate physical CPU
D) Containers cannot run applications

,Answer: B) Containers generally share the host operating-system
kernel
Rationale: Containers typically isolate applications and their
dependencies while sharing the host kernel. This generally makes
containers more lightweight and faster to start than full virtual
machines. A conventional virtual machine normally includes a guest
operating system and its own kernel, operating through a hypervisor.
Container isolation can be strong, but it is architecturally different
from VM isolation.


4. Networking
A workstation wants to communicate with a server on a different IP
subnet. Which network device is primarily responsible for determining
the appropriate path between the two networks?
A) Switch
B) Hub
C) Router
D) Repeater
Answer: C) Router
Rationale: A router operates at the network layer and makes
forwarding decisions based primarily on IP addresses and routing
information. A Layer 2 switch primarily forwards Ethernet frames
using MAC addresses within a local network. A hub simply repeats
signals to connected ports, while a repeater regenerates signals rather
than making routing decisions.

, A user enters https://example.com into a browser. Before the browser
can establish the HTTPS connection, the system may need to determine
the IP address associated with the domain name. Which protocol/service
performs this function?
A) SMTP
B) DNS
C) SSH
D) FTP
Answer: B) DNS
Rationale: DNS translates human-readable domain names into IP
addresses and can also provide other types of resource records. The
browser can then use the resulting IP address to establish a network
connection. HTTPS provides secure web communication, SMTP
handles email transmission, and SSH provides secure remote
administration.
